	HUMBOLDT STATE:  Enters her fourth campaign with the Jacks.
	
	ON THE COURT: One of team captains ... returning starter at center ... continues to provide leadership ... counting upon to be a dominate force inside ... physically strong presence offensively and defensively. 
	
	CAREER: 60 games - 273 points (4.6 ppg) on 111 of 266 field goals (.417); 236 rebounds (3.9 rpg); 50 assists; 31 blocks and 24 steals.
	
	2012-13: Started 25 of 27 games played ... career best averages of 6.9 points and 5.8 rbounds per night ... finished with 185 points by making 78 of 170 shots (45.9%) ... grabbed 156 rebounds with 99 coming on the defensive end ... swatted away 21 opposing shots ... added 33 assists and 15 steals ... made 10 of 14 shots for a season-high 21 points to go with nine caroms, three assists and a block vs. Cal State Stanislaus ... recorded a double-double of 12 points and 10 rebounds vs. San Francisco State ... five contests with double digit scoring with 18 points on nine of 11 tries vs. Simpson ... clutched four double figure rebound nights with season-best 12 vs. Cal State East Bay ... blocked three shots two times with the last coming at Cal State Monterey Bay ... stole two balls four times.
	
	2011-12: Played in seven games as a reserve ... averaged 8.9 minutes per game ... finished two of three in free throw attempts ... snagged seven rebounds, including four putbacks ... assisted on two baskets and blocked one shot ... finished with eight points on the season.
	
	2010-11: Appeared in all 27 contests as a true freshmen, starting five games ... averaged 13 minutes per game, 3.0 points and 2.7 rebounds per contest ... accumulated 15 assists, nine blocks and nine steals.
	
	HIGH SCHOOL:  Played basketball at Yamhill Carlton High (Ore.) ... named to the 4A All-State first team as senior ... honored as the Cowapa League Player of the Year, while averaging 13 points and 13 rebounds per game final year … earned All-Cowapa League first team as a junior and sophomore and all-state second team honors as a junior.
	
	PERSONAL: Born April 3, 1991 … parents are Joni and Dean Anderson ... special education major ... brother Zach and father played football at Oregon State and mother played volleyball at Washington State ... interests include travel, hiking, surfing and spending time with friends.
